Quick question, are Spiked Shields considered Spiked Armor for the purpose of feats?
Specifically Spiked Destroyer?

I'm a little confused by the sentence "See the armor spikes entry on page 10 for details."

Can anyone help clarify the relation between Spiked Shields and Spiked Armor?


First off Armor Spikes and Shield Spikes are different, it references "Armor Spikes" on your armor, shields don’t get armor spikes.

Secondly the feat mentions armor, not shields, even though a shield may be in the armor section of the books, it doesn’t mentions shields so by RAW this would apply to armor with armor spikes only.

Spiked Shields:
SPIKED HEAVY SHIELD PRICE 57 GP/70 GP
TYPE martial
Spiked shields are intimidating weapons, and can have a single
protruding central spike, razored shield edges, or a whole forest
of deadly protrusions. You can bash with a spiked heavy shield
instead of using it for defense. A spiked heavy shield can’t be
disarmed. See the armor spikes entry on page 10 for details.
SPIKED LIGHT SHIELD PRICE 53 GP/59 GP
TYPE martial
You can bash with a spiked light shield instead of using it for
defense. A spiked light shield can’t be disarmed. See the armor
spikes entry on page 10 for details.
